Why Are Birch Trees So Iconic in Russian Landscapes?

The birch tree is basically the face of Russia’s landscape. With its slim, white bark and elegant branches, it’s instantly recognizable—and it stands for purity, strength, and endurance in Russian culture. You’ll find birches all over Russian literature, music, and art, often symbolizing the heart of Russia’s rural life. Historically, birches were like the village guardians, offering shelter and wood to the people. Now, the birch is more than just a tree—it’s a symbol of Russian spirit and resilience, deeply woven into the country’s cultural fabric.

How Many Types of Wildflowers Can You Find in Russia’s Spring Fields?

If there’s one thing you can’t miss in the Russian countryside during spring, it’s the wildflowers. From vibrant marigolds and cheerful daisies to bold poppies and delicate cornflowers, the fields explode in color. Scientists say there are hundreds of wildflower species across the Russian meadows, some even packed with medicinal power. These flowers do more than just look pretty—they support the entire ecosystem, giving pollinators a place to feast. For Russians, these wildflowers are the true heralds of spring, marking the season’s grand entrance with their bright blooms.
